Does the ear thermometer measure from the air-conditioned room to the place where there is no air conditioning?
When the ear thermometer is from an air-conditioned room to a place without air conditioning, since it has not adapted to the rapid change of the ambient temperature, it is recommended in this case that the user should first place the ear thermometer for about 20 minutes and then adapt it to the ambient temperature. You can get the correct measurement temperature.

Does the ear thermometer emit infrared light?
The ear thermometer is converted into body temperature by receiving infrared rays emitted from the human eardrum, so it receives infrared rays without emitting.
Please pay attention to straighten the ear canal when using
Method: 1. As long as you gently pull the baby's ear gently back (adult is upward), make sure to straighten the ear canal and let the ear thermometer probe measure the straight eardrum.
Why is the temperature of my measurement too low?
You can check if your ear canal is clean, as earwax can impede the accuracy of infrared measurements.
